> Is there anything I can do to recover /etc/passwd First off, BACKUP EVERYTHING RIGHT NOW! Seriously, before you do anything else.
Then you can recover your /etc/passwd file by copying /etc/master.passwd to a temporary place. Edit this temporary file replacing all the encrypted passwords with a single character '*' and remove fields 5, 6, and 7 then write this file back out as /etc/passwd. Paul A.
